如何将聊天文字转语音应用于语音助手?

随着科技的不断发展,人工智能技术已经渗透到了我们生活的方方面面。语音助手作为人工智能的一个重要应用,越来越受到人们的关注。而将聊天文字转语音技术应用于语音助手,则可以进一步提升语音助手的智能化水平。本文将详细介绍如何将聊天文字转语音应用于语音助手。

一、聊天文字转语音技术简介

聊天文字转语音技术,又称语音合成技术,是将文本信息转换为自然、流畅的语音输出的技术。该技术主要包括以下几个步骤:

  1. 文本预处理:对输入的文本进行分词、词性标注、句法分析等处理,提取出文本中的关键信息。

  2. 语音合成:根据提取出的关键信息,选择合适的语音参数,如音调、音量、语速等,生成语音波形。

  3. 语音后处理:对生成的语音波形进行降噪、回声消除等处理,提高语音质量。

二、聊天文字转语音在语音助手中的应用

  1. 语音输入识别

在语音助手中,用户可以通过语音输入指令,语音助手将语音信号转换为文本信息,然后根据文本信息执行相应的操作。将聊天文字转语音技术应用于语音输入识别,可以提升语音识别的准确率和用户体验。


  1. 语音播报

语音助手可以将文本信息转换为语音播报,如天气预报、新闻资讯、日程提醒等。通过聊天文字转语音技术,语音助手可以播报更加自然、流畅的语音,提升用户体验。


  1. 语音回复

当用户提出问题时,语音助手可以通过聊天文字转语音技术生成语音回复。这样,用户在等待语音助手回复的过程中,可以更加直观地了解回复内容,提高沟通效率。


  1. 语音交互

在语音交互过程中,语音助手可以实时地将文本信息转换为语音输出,让用户感受到更加自然的交流体验。例如,在聊天过程中,语音助手可以将用户的输入实时转换为语音,再输出给对方,实现双向语音交流。


  1. 语音合成训练

为了提高语音助手在特定领域的语音合成效果,可以通过收集大量领域的文本数据,对语音合成模型进行训练。这样,语音助手可以生成更加贴近用户需求的语音输出。

三、实现聊天文字转语音在语音助手中的应用

  1. 选择合适的语音合成技术

目前,市场上常见的语音合成技术有基于规则的方法、基于统计的方法和基于深度学习的方法。在语音助手应用中,建议选择基于深度学习的方法,因为其语音质量更高、更加自然。


  1. 开发语音合成模型

根据实际需求,选择合适的语音合成模型,如WaveNet、Tacotron等。通过训练和优化模型,提高语音合成效果。


  1. 集成语音合成技术

将语音合成技术集成到语音助手系统中,实现文本到语音的转换。同时,确保语音合成与语音识别、语音播报等模块的协同工作。


  1. 优化语音合成效果

针对语音助手在不同场景下的应用,对语音合成效果进行优化。例如,针对特定领域的语音合成,可以收集相关领域的文本数据,对模型进行针对性训练。


  1. 提升用户体验

在语音助手应用中,关注用户体验至关重要。通过优化语音合成效果、提升语音识别准确率、丰富语音交互功能等手段,提高语音助手的用户满意度。

总之,将聊天文字转语音技术应用于语音助手,可以有效提升语音助手的智能化水平,为用户提供更加便捷、高效的语音交互体验。随着技术的不断发展,相信未来语音助手将在更多领域发挥重要作用。

猜你喜欢:企业即时通讯平台